Can you rupture your eardrum from blowing your nose too hard?

WebDec 10, 2024 · In severe cases, blowing your nose too hard can cause you an earache or even rupture your eardrum. The nose, ear, and mouth are connected. However, a forceful nose-blow can cause a rapid change in pressure behind the eardrum. WebApr 12, 2024 · A ruptured ear drum or perforated eardrum, or tympanic membrane perforation, is a hole in the membrane that separates the ear canal from the middle ear. The perforation can result in hearing loss and can also lead to various infections of the ear.
